How do i tell apache that they all point to the same directory?
 

chrishirst

Well-Known Member
Staff member
The quick answer is to add them all as virtual hosts that share the same root directory. However:

To make sure you aren't being penalised for duplicate content by Google at al you should use a 301 permanent redirect from all but one of them to the remaining one.
